Output fd028d981a66eef413565ea0583d567351699eab448a0f0bcdbf6a76ce2a7986:2

value
12573083
script pubkey
OP_0 OP_PUSHBYTES_20 12504393de2cc845f702b8492a3e27c8714a83f6
address
ltc1qzfgy8y779nyytaczhpyj5038epc54qlkhc5m55
transaction
fd028d981a66eef413565ea0583d567351699eab448a0f0bcdbf6a76ce2a7986
spent
true